システムプロパティにフィヌルドを远加する方法

ご存じのように、レゞストリ、぀たり既存のものを倉曎したり、新しいパヌティションずパラメヌタヌを远加したりするこずで、Windowsオペレヌティングシステムで倚くのこずができたす。 コントロヌルパネルで䜿甚可胜なオプションを倉曎したり、远加のシステムコンポヌネントをカスタマむズしたり、タスクバヌずデスクトップをカスタマむズしたり、既存のものを倉曎したり、さたざたなコンテキストメニュヌに新しいアむテムを远加したりできたす。 レゞストリのどのパラメヌタヌを倉曎たたは远加するかを知っおいる堎合、システムを䞀意に構成できるだけでなく、このプロセスを完党に自動化できるため、間違いなく非垞に䟿利です。

いく぀かの可倉パラメヌタヌは、同じプロセスモニタヌたたはRegMonナヌティリティを䜿甚しお非垞に単玔にロヌカラむズできたす蚘事「 レゞストリの監芖の䟋 」でこれらのナヌティリティに぀いお説明したした。たた、いく぀かのパラメヌタヌを䜿甚しお、簡単に蚀うず、ロヌカラむズは䞀芋思われるよりもはるかに難しい堎合がありたす。 目的のパラメヌタヌの倀を䜿甚するず、すべおが非垞に単玔な堎合がありたすたずえば、DWORDパラメヌタヌの堎合、倀を決定する際に問題が発生したせん。たた、固有倀を生成するタスクは非垞に困難な堎合がありたすたずえばWindows 8.1オペレヌティングシステムのロック画面の写真を撮るディレクトリの堎所を担圓するパラメヌタヌの倀です。 パラメヌタヌ自䜓ずその倀の䞡方の䟋は無限にありたす。

今日、この短い蚘事では、システムプロパティりィンドりに远加のナヌザヌ情報を远加できるレゞストリ蚭定に぀いお孊習したす。 さらに、それをより面癜くするために、パラメヌタヌは䞭倮に远加されたす。 グルヌプポリシヌの基本蚭定の機胜を䜿甚したす。 始めるこずができるず思いたす。



システムプロパティの远加フィヌルドを担圓するレゞストリパラメヌタのロヌカラむズ



たず、[ システムのプロパティ]コントロヌルパネルのコンポヌネントに衚瀺される情報の名前を芚えおおく必芁がありたす。 Microsoftの公匏゜ヌスからの情報によるず、「機噚メヌカヌはコンピュヌタヌ技術たたはOEMのサプラむダヌずも呌ばれおいたす」。 したがっお、システムプロパティに衚瀺される情報はOEM情報ず呌ばれるず結論付けるこずができたす。 最初に、TechNetたたはMSDNからダりンロヌドした適切なディスクたたはむメヌゞからむンストヌルされたクリヌンなオペレヌティングシステムでは、システムの元のむメヌゞを䜿甚する時間がなかったため、そのような情報は単玔に欠萜しおいたす。

システムレゞストリにパラメヌタヌが最初に存圚しない堎合、監芖ツヌルを䜿甚しおパラメヌタヌを芋぀けるこずは困難な堎合がありたす。この䟋のように、さらに悪いこずに、たったく䞍可胜です。 このため、必芁なパラメヌタヌをロヌカラむズするには、オペレヌティングシステムの独自の䞀意のむメヌゞを䜜成できる「 Windows Installation Manager 」 System Image Manager、SIM を利甚する必芁がありたす。

Windows Installation Managerを䜿甚するず、むンストヌルされおいるWindowsの゚ディションの蚭定を倉曎できたす。 利甚可胜なオプションを決定するために、Windows Installation Managerはカタログファむルを䜜成し、その内容を読み取りたす 。 カタログファむルは、特定のWindowsむメヌゞで䜿甚可胜なすべおのオプションのリストを含む小さなファむルです。 ぀たり、メむンのWindowsむメヌゞのファむル\ Sources \ Install.wimをWindowsむンストヌルDVD-ROMから遞択したホストコンピュヌタヌのフォルダヌにコピヌしたす。 ぀たり、SIMマネヌゞャヌで、Windowsむメヌゞグルヌプに移動し、むンストヌルディスクから以前にコピヌしたファむルを遞択したす。 以前にディレクトリファむルを䜜成しおいない堎合、マネヌゞャはこの段階でそのようなファむルが䜜成されるこずを譊告したす。 .wimファむルに耇数のシステムむメヌゞが含たれおいる堎合、特定のむメヌゞを遞択するよう求められたす。 その埌、Windows Installation Managerは、Install.wimファむルで遞択したむメヌゞファむルに基づいおディレクトリファむルを䜜成したす。 原則ずしお、次の図に芋られるように、このプロセスには少し時間がかかり、数分かかるこずがありたす。





図 1.カタログファむルを䜜成し、オペレヌティングシステムむメヌゞを远加する



その埌、Windowsのむンストヌルを自動化するためのすべおのパラメヌタヌを含む応答ファむルが䜜成されたす。 これも難しい䜜業ではありたせん。 [ファむル ]メニュヌ [ ファむル ] > [新芏回答ファむル] から[新芏回答ファむル ]コマンドを遞択するだけで、その埌、必芁な構成手順が応答ファむルのパネルに衚瀺されたす。 セットアップ手順は、Windowsむンストヌルのフェヌズであり、その間にむメヌゞをカスタマむズできたす。 Windows自動むンストヌルオプションは、䜿甚しおいるオプションに応じお、1぀以䞊の構成手順で適甚できたす。 この䟋では、関心のある構成手順はoobeSystemず呌ばれたす。 通垞、この手順は、Windowsシェル蚭定の構成、ナヌザヌアカりントの䜜成、および蚀語ず地域の蚭定の指定に䜿甚されたす。

たた、この段階に必芁な手順を远加するには、オペレヌティングシステムの特定のコンポヌネントを远加する必芁がありたす。 すべおのコンポヌネントは、Windowsむメヌゞペむンにあるコンポヌネントノヌドにありたす。 最も重芁なこずは、远加するコンポヌネントず目的を理解するこずです。 OEM情報に関心があるため、必芁なコンポヌネントをロヌカラむズするこずは難しくありたせん。 Microsoft-Windows-Shell-Setup> OEMInformationず呌ばれたす。このようなコンポヌネントを芋぀けたら 、残りはoobeSystemステヌゞに远加するだけで、これは7番目のパスずも呌ばれたす。 これを远加するには、そのようなコンポヌネントを遞択し、そのコンテキストメニュヌを呌び出しお、「 蚭定をPass 7 oobeSystemに远加 」コマンドを遞択する必芁がありたす。 远加プロセスを以䞋に瀺したす。





図 2. 7番目のパスにコンポヌネントを远加する



その埌、レゞストリで必芁なパラメヌタを芋぀けるこずは難しくありたせん。 応答ファむルの7番目のパスに移動しお、远加したコンポヌネントを芋぀けるだけです。 右偎の远加したコンポヌネントのプロパティパネルには、オペレヌティングシステムで倉曎できるすべおのパラメヌタヌが衚瀺されたす。 次の図でわかるように、OEM情報を倉曎するには、次のパラメヌタヌを䜿甚できたすシステムレゞストリ内のパラメヌタヌは同じ名前で䜜成されたす。



これらのパラメヌタヌは以䞋のずおりです。





図 3. Windows Installation ManagerのOEM情報蚭定



パラメヌタを既に把握しおいるため、レゞストリ蚭定のロヌカラむズに関する問題を郚分的に解決したした。 ただし、そのようなパラメヌタヌが䜜成される堎所を正確に芋぀ける必芁がありたす。 セクション自䜓をどのように芋぀けるこずができたすか これも耇雑ではありたせん。 どのレゞストリキヌが䜿甚されるかを確認するには、むンストヌルむメヌゞを䜜成し、テスト察象の仮想たたは物理マシンに展開する必芁がありたす。 その埌、レゞストリ゚ディタヌを開き、远加したコンポヌネント、぀たりOEMInformationに䞀臎するレゞストリキヌを怜玢する必芁がありたす。 これらのすべおの文字列型パラメヌタヌREG_SZは、 HKLM \ SOFTWARE \ Microsoft \ Windows \ CurrentVersion \ OEMInformationセクションに保存されたす。 次の図でわかるように、このセクションでは構成した蚭定を芋぀けるこずができ、 「システム」りィンドりは右の図に瀺すようになりたす。





図 4.システムレゞストリのパラメヌタヌずその適甚結果



以前に展開されたシステムぞのOEM情報の䞀元的な配垃



クラむアントコンピュヌタヌにオペレヌティングシステムを既にむンストヌルしおおり、その埌、以前に怜蚎したパラメヌタヌを倉曎する必芁がある堎合は、圓然グルヌプポリシヌの機胜を利甚できたす。 ご想像のずおり、このような情報を蚭定するための管理甚テンプレヌトポリシヌ蚭定は存圚したせん。 このため、回避策を利甚する必芁がありたす。぀たり、グルヌプポリシヌの蚭定を有効にする必芁がありたす。

Windows 8.1がむンストヌルされおいるコンピュヌタヌのシステムプロパティりィンドりのみを倉曎する必芁があるずしたす。 この堎合、このタスク党䜓を条件付きで3段階に分けるこずができたす。぀たり、クラむアントコンピュヌタヌの同じ堎所に目的のむメヌゞをコピヌし、新しいシステムレゞストリパラメヌタヌを䜜成し、䜜成したパラメヌタヌを特定のコンピュヌタヌサヌクル Windows 8.1で動䜜したす。 すべおを順番に考えおみたしょう。

  1. 最初に、 グルヌプポリシヌ管理スナップむンを開き、GPOタヌゲット OEMInfoなどを䜜成しおから、そのようなオブゞェクトのコンテキストメニュヌからグルヌプポリシヌ管理゚ディタヌスナップむンを開く必芁がありたす。
  2. 既に衚瀺されおいるスナップむンでは、これらのパラメヌタヌはログむンしたナヌザヌずは無関係であり、レゞストリ蚭定はHK_LOCAL_MACHINEセクションにあるため、 [ コンピュヌタヌの構成]ノヌドに移動し、 [蚭定] \ [Windows蚭定] \ [ファむル]ノヌドに移動したす» 環境蚭定\ Windows蚭定\ファむル 、詳现ペむンのコンテキストメニュヌを呌び出し、「コマンドを䜜成 」、次に「 ファむル 」 新芏>ファむル を遞択したす。
  3. 新しいファむルプロパティの基本蚭定項目のダむアログボックスで、[ 䜜成]アクションを遞択し、テキストボックス「 ゜ヌスファむル 」および「 最終ファむル 」 ゜ヌスファむル耇数可および宛先ファむル で共有ファむルにコピヌするファむルぞのパスを指定したすリ゜ヌス\\ DC \ Logo \ Biohazard.bmpなどおよびクラむアントマシン䞊のファむルぞの新しいパスc\ OEMLOGO \ Biohazard.bmpなど。 䜜成された基本蚭定項目のダむアログボックスを以䞋に瀺したす。





    図 5.ファむル蚭定項目



  4. ここで、6぀のレゞストリ蚭定すべおを䜜成する必芁がありたす。 これを行うには、同じ「 Windows構成 」ノヌドで、「 レゞストリ 」ノヌドに移動したす。 ここで、詳现領域で最初の基本蚭定項目を䜜成するには、コンテキストメニュヌから[ 䜜成 ]および[レゞストリ項目 ][ 新芏]> [レゞストリ項目] を遞択する必芁がありたす。
  5. 新しいレゞストリ蚭定項目のダむアログボックスで、前の堎合よりもはるかに倚くのパラメヌタヌを入力する必芁がありたす。 ここでは、レゞストリ蚭定が初めお䜜成されるため、アクションのドロップダりンリストから[ 䜜成]コマンドを遞択する必芁がありたす。 「 ハむブ 」ドロップダりンリストから、必芁なパラメヌタヌが䜜成されるレゞストリキヌを遞択したす。 この堎合、それはHKEY_LOCAL_MACHINEになりたす 。 「 キヌパス 」テキストボックスを䜿甚しお、パラメヌタヌを䜜成するセクションを定矩する必芁がありたす。 このセクションは最初はレゞストリ゚ディタで利甚できないため、レゞストリ゚ントリのブラりザを呌び出すこずは無意味であり、パス党䜓を手動で入力する必芁がありたす。 この䟋では、このパスはSOFTWARE \ Microsoft \ Windows \ CurrentVersion \ OEMInformationのようになりたす。 䞊蚘の3぀のパラメヌタヌは、䜜成された6぀の蚭定項目すべおで同䞀です。 次の3぀のパラメヌタヌ「 パラメヌタヌ名 」、「 パラメヌタヌタむプ 」、「 倀 」 倀名 、 倀タむプ 、 倀デヌタ を䜿甚しお、パラメヌタヌの名前 Logoなど 、そのタむプ、 REG_SZが参照する6぀すべおの堎合 、および倀自䜓も、このパラメヌタヌの堎合は「 C\ OEMLOGO \ Biohazard.bmp 」のようになりたす。 レゞストリ蚭定項目の䞀般的なパラメヌタヌのデヌタ入力タブのダむアログボックスを以䞋に瀺したす。





    図 6.レゞストリ蚭定項目の䜜成



  6. 残りの5぀の基本蚭定項目をすばやく䜜成するには、䜜成した最初の項目をクリップボヌドにコピヌしお、5回連続で貌り付け操䜜を実行したす。 その埌、耇補された蚭定項目のプロパティダむアログで最埌の3぀のパラメヌタヌを倉曎するだけで、必芁なすべおの項目が䜜成されたす。 最終的に、グルヌプポリシヌ管理゚ディタヌのスナップむンりィンドりは次のようになりたす。





    図 7.蚭定項目が䜜成されたグルヌプポリシヌ管理゚ディタヌ



  7. 生成された基本蚭定項目をタヌゲットにするタスクが残っおいたす。 それを実行するには、蚭定項目のプロパティのダむアログボックスを開き、「 䞀般オプション 」タブに移動したす。 ここで、「 アむテムレベルのタヌゲティング 」ボックスをチェックし、「 タヌゲティング 」ボタンをクリックしお、タヌゲティング゚ディタヌに移動する必芁がありたす。 タヌゲティング゚ディタヌで、䜜成芁玠のリストから「 オペレヌティングシステム 」芁玠を遞択し、補品のドロップダりンリストでタヌゲットオペレヌティングシステムがWindows 8.1であるこずを瀺す必芁がありたす。 タヌゲティング芁玠を远加したら、蚭定芁玠ぞの倉曎を保存できたす。 次の図に、タヌゲティング゚ディタヌを瀺したす。





    図 8.以前に䜜成した蚭定項目のタヌゲティング゚ディタヌ



  8. すべおのアクションが完了したら、GPME゚ディタヌのスナップむンを閉じお、GPOを必芁なナニットに関連付け、タヌゲットコンピュヌタヌのポリシヌ蚭定を曎新しおください。


最終的に、クラむアントコンピュヌタヌのポリシヌ蚭定を曎新した埌、システムプロパティりィンドりは珟圚の蚘事の図4ずたったく同じように芋えるはずです。

おわりに



この蚘事では、Windowsオペレヌティングシステムのプロパティりィンドりに新しいフィヌルドを远加するために必芁なレゞストリのパラメヌタヌを芋぀けお䜜成する方法を孊びたした。 Windows Installation Managerを䜿甚しおこのようなパラメヌタヌを怜玢するためのアルゎリズムず、グルヌプポリシヌ機胜を䜿甚した集䞭構成の原則が怜蚎されたした。 この蚘事の情報がお圹に立おば幞いです。レゞストリ蚭定ずグルヌプポリシヌコントロヌルの䜿甚が困難な特定のシナリオを実行する方法を知りたい堎合は、このシナリオに぀いおのコメントに曞いおください。グルヌプポリシヌの機胜の䜿甚に関する次の蚘事のいずれかで、質問の解析を詊みたす。



All Articles